Gletterens (French pronunciation: [ɡlɛtəʁɑ̃s]) is a municipality in the district of Broye, in the canton of Fribourg, Switzerland.
It is home to the Les Grèves prehistoric pile-dwelling (or stilt house) settlements that are part of the Prehistoric Pile dwellings around the Alps UNESCO World Heritage Site.
